Re: Username and Computer Name
On 2012-05-14 21:19Z, max@kalani.com wrote:
> I am installing cygwin on a new computer and I was told that the green
> "username@computername ' " is supposed to be hidden, and that I
> somehow installed Cygwin improperly.
That's a normal part of the default bash prompt. (Perhaps your
employer would prefer that you remove it?)
> Could someone please explain how to hide or setup cygwin properly to
> not show this?
Run 'man bash' and look for PS1. Remove the '\u@\h' part. To make
the change permanent, set your own PS1 in '~/.bash_profile'. This
isn't cygwin specific, so you can google for more details.
